Прочитать на английском

Поделиться через


Объект UserAccess (Excel)

Представляет доступ пользователя к защищенному диапазону.

Пример

Используйте метод Add или свойство Item коллекции UserAccessList , чтобы вернуть объект UserAccess .

После возврата объекта UserAccess можно определить, разрешен ли доступ для определенного диапазона на листе с помощью свойства AllowEdit .

В следующем примере добавляется диапазон, который можно изменить на защищенном листе, и уведомляет пользователя о заголовке этого диапазона.

Sub UseAllowEditRanges() 
 
 Dim wksSheet As Worksheet 
 
 Set wksSheet = Application.ActiveSheet 
 
 ' Add a range that can be edited on the protected worksheet. 
 wksSheet.Protection.AllowEditRanges.Add "Test", Range("A1") 
 
 ' Notify the user the title of the range that can be edited. 
 MsgBox wksSheet.Protection.AllowEditRanges(1).Title 
 
End Sub

Методы

Свойства

См. также

Поддержка и обратная связь

Есть вопросы или отзывы, касающиеся Office VBA или этой статьи? Руководство по другим способам получения поддержки и отправки отзывов см. в статье Поддержка Office VBA и обратная связь.